(1) If a party files a motion to dismiss before or at the time of filing an answer and pursuant to the provisions of this Code section, discovery shall be stayed for 90 days after the filing of such motion or until the ruling of the court on such motion, whichever is sooner.
(e) Dismissal for want of prosecution; recommencement. Any action in which no written order is taken for a period of five years shall automatically stand dismissed, with costs to be taxed against the party plaintiff. For the purposes of this Code section, an order of continuance will be deemed an order.

Under Georgia law, with some limitations, a plaintiff can voluntarily dismiss a lawsuit without prejudice and refile the lawsuit. The lawsuit may be refiled ?either within the original applicable period of limitations or within six months after the discontinuance or dismissal, whichever is later.? O.C.G.A. § 9-2-61.
